Output 76ad161fda829287aa43c6fc4e03fcac777d8037bd2f667bc2a238800c385a17:12

value
23168437
script pubkey
OP_0 OP_PUSHBYTES_20 ded1c6deee4f1bdaa7f93d635222509cdfc2ef89
address
bc1qmmgudhhwfuda4fle8434ygjsnn0u9muf0nvw83
transaction
76ad161fda829287aa43c6fc4e03fcac777d8037bd2f667bc2a238800c385a17